Dr. Craig Smith is an optometrist practicing in Midvale, UT. Dr. Smith specializing in providing eye care services to patients. As an optometrist, Dr. Smith performs eye exams, tests vision, corrects vision by prescribing eye glasses or contacts, detects certain eye disorders and manages and treats vision problems. Optometrists often work closely with ophthalmologists who may need to further treat patients with surgical procedures.
